MIDDLEBURY, Vt.–Two credit unions have selected solutions from eDOC Innovations.
Among the CUs adopting eDOC Signature is Trademark Federal Credit Union, in Augusta, Maine, which adopted the solution to provide greater convenience and more comprehensive services to its growing community of mobile members. The ability to send documents out for esign will speed up member transactions and allows credit union staff to service member needs anytime, anywhere, the company said.

Coloramo FCU Also Signs On
Also signing with eDOC Innovations for its eDOCSignature solution is Coloramo FCU in Grand Junction, Colo. Integrated with the credit union’s FLEX core processing system, eDOCSignature’s capabilities provide state-of-the-art automation for the credit union and convenience to the mobile member by meeting them where they are, anytime, anywhere, the CUSO said.

FLEX, a credit union core data processing solution provider based in Sandy, Utah, partnered with eDOC Innovations in 2017 to offer eDOCSignature to its credit union members.
